Transaction daddbf70f277c84e4abe141b2a68b5c3ee341fc178b9ea63435aab24dee20d64

block
e1d06f7a755ec5e54f0c9dda3f670abe3cdde511980f0b0933110015e24e0d39

1 Input

23 Outputs